      标题:社会支持对肺动脉高压患者生活质量的影响

      【摘要】 目的 了解肺动脉高压患者的生活质量,并探讨社会支持对肺动脉高压患者生活质量的影响。方法 采用整群抽样的方法选择2014年12月至2015年8月期间在解放军总医院海南分院住院治疗的84例肺动脉高压患者作为研究对象。分别采用简明健康调查量表(SF-36)和社会支持评定量表(SSRS)对患者的生活质量及社会支持进行问卷调查。结果 肺动脉高压患者生活质量各维度得分均低于常模,差异均有统计学意义(P<0.05);Pearson相关分析显示,肺动脉高压患者的社会支持总分与生活质量的生理功能(r=0.169,P<0.05)、生理职能(r=0.159,P<0.05)、躯体疼痛(r=0.239,P<0.05)、总体健康(r=0.225,P<0.05)、活力(r=0.247,P<0.05)、社会功能(r=0.223,P<0.05)、情感职能(r=0.279,P<0.05)及精神健康维度(r=0.509,P<0.05)得分均呈正相关。多元线性回归分析显示,影响肺动脉高压者生活质量的因素有:性别(β=-0.373,P<0.05)、6 min步行距离(β=-0.354,P<0.05)、是否合并右心衰竭(β=-0.109,P<0.05)及社会支持水平(β=0.233,P<0.05)。结论 肺动脉高压患者的生活质量不容乐观,今后应采取积极措施,特别是通过改善社会支持来提高患者的生活质量。

Effect of social support on quality of life among patients with pulmonary arterial hypertension.

【Abstract】 Objective To investigate the quality of life (QOL) in patients with pulmonary arterial hyperten-sion and to explore the effect of social support on quality of life among patients with pulmonary arterial hypertension.Methods A total of 84 patients with pulmonary arterial hypertension, who admitted to Hainan Branch of PLA GeneralHospital from December 2014 to August 2015, were selected as the research objects according to cluster sampling meth-od. QOL and social support were evaluated by the Medical Outcomes Study (MOS) 36-item short form health survey(SF-36) and the Social Support Rating Scale (SSRS), respectively. Results Compared with the general population, alldimension scores of SF-36 scale were significantly lower in patients with pulmonary arterial hypertension (P<0.05).Pearson correlation analysis showed that social support was significantly positively correlated with physical functioning(r=0.169, P<0.05), physical role (r=0.159, P<0.05), body pain (r=0.239, P<0.05), general health (r=0.225, P<0.05), vi-tality (r=0.247, P<0.05), social functioning (r=0.223, P<0.05), emotional role (r=0.279, P<0.05) and mental health (r=0.509, P<0.05) among patients with pulmonary arterial hypertension. The results of multiple linear regression analysisshowed that the associated factors of QOL were gender (β=-0.373, P<0.05), 6-minute walking distance (β=-0.354, P<0.05), right heart failure or not (β=-0.109, P<0.05) and social support (β=0.233, P<0.05). Conclusion The QOL of pa-tients with pulmonary arterial hypertension is not optimistic. In order to enhance the QOL of patients with pulmonary ar-terial hypertension, effective measures should be taken, especially measures about social support.
